
Handel algorytmiczny to sposób zawierania transakcji na rynkach finansowych, w którym do automatycznego realizowania zleceń kupna i sprzedaży wykorzystywane są zaawansowane algorytmy komputerowe. W tym modelu decyzje inwestycyjne, takie jak wybór momentu wejścia i wyjścia z pozycji czy wielkość transakcji, podejmowane są przez systemy komputerowe, bez konieczności każdorazowej interwencji człowieka podczas realizacji operacji. Ten rodzaj handlu opiera się na wcześniej ustalonych regułach matematycznych, analizie danych rynkowych oraz często na zaawansowanej analizie statystycznej.
Najważniejsze cechy handlu algorytmicznego
- Automatyzacja procesu transakcyjnego – Handel algorytmiczny opiera się na wykorzystaniu systemów komputerowych, które automatycznie generują i przesyłają zlecenia na giełdę według określonych algorytmów.
- Optymalizacja wykonywania zleceń – Głównym celem stosowania handlu algorytmicznego jest skrócenie czasu realizacji transakcji oraz minimalizacja kosztów związanych z obrotem aktywami.
- Eliminowanie wpływu emocji inwestora – Proces decyzyjny zachodzi w pełni automatycznie, dzięki czemu ograniczony zostaje negatywny wpływ emocjonalnych decyzji charakterystycznych dla inwestorów indywidualnych.
- Wykorzystanie i analiza dużych wolumenów danych – Algorytmy handlowe pozwalają na bieżącą analizę ogromnych ilości danych rynkowych w celu identyfikacji optymalnych okazji transakcyjnych i szybkiego reagowania na zmiany rynkowe.
Główne zastosowania handlu algorytmicznego
- Rynek akcji – Automatyczne strategie kupna i sprzedaży akcji oraz wykorzystanie strategii arbitrażowych polegających na wykorzystywaniu różnic cenowych pomiędzy instrumentami finansowymi.
- Rynek walutowy (forex) – Błyskawiczne wykonywanie transakcji na globalnych rynkach walutowych oraz wykorzystywanie niewielkich zmian kursów w celu osiągania zysków w krótkich interwałach czasowych.
- Towary (np. złoto) – Implementacja algorytmów analizujących wahania cen surowców, takich jak złoto, i podejmujących decyzje inwestycyjne na podstawie wzorców i trendów rynkowych.
- Instrumenty pochodne – Automatyczne zarządzanie portfelem instrumentów pochodnych, modelowanie strategii zabezpieczających (hedgingowych) oraz dynamiczne dostosowywanie pozycji względem zmienności rynku.
Najpopularniejsze strategie algorytmiczne
- Handel wysokich częstotliwości (HFT) – Polega na realizowaniu bardzo dużej liczby transakcji w bardzo krótkim czasie, często w milisekundowych interwałach, z wykorzystaniem ultra-szybkich systemów komputerowych. Celem jest maksymalizacja zysków z niewielkich ruchów cenowych na rynku.
- Market making (tworzenie rynku) – Polega na jednoczesnym składaniu zleceń kupna i sprzedaży tych samych aktywów w celu zapewnienia płynności na rynku. Market makerzy zarabiają na różnicy pomiędzy ceną kupna a ceną sprzedaży (spreadem).
- Algorytmy arbitrażowe – Służą do wykorzystywania nieefektywności cenowych na różnych rynkach lub pomiędzy powiązanymi instrumentami finansowymi. Pozwalają na osiąganie zysków dzięki szybkiemu reagowaniu na istniejące różnice cenowe.
- Algorytmy egzekucyjne (optymalizacja realizacji zleceń) – Ich zadaniem jest minimalizowanie wpływu dużych zleceń na rynek, często poprzez dzielenie zlecenia na mniejsze części i realizowanie ich w określonych odstępach czasu.
- Algorytmy oparte na analizie statystycznej – Wykorzystują zaawansowane techniki statystyczne oraz modele matematyczne do identyfikowania wzorców cenowych i generowania sygnałów transakcyjnych na podstawie danych historycznych i bieżących.
Najważniejsze zalety i ograniczenia
Zalety:
- Szybkość realizacji transakcji – Pozwala na natychmiastowe reagowanie na zmiany rynkowe i egzekwowanie zleceń nawet w ułamkach sekundy.
- Precyzja i brak wpływu emocji – Decyzje podejmowane są na podstawie obiektywnych parametrów algorytmów, eliminując czynniki psychologiczne towarzyszące handlowi manualnemu.
- Możliwość przetwarzania dużych zbiorów danych – Umożliwia analizę ogromnych ilości informacji rynkowych, co może prowadzić do skuteczniejszego wykrywania okazji inwestycyjnych.
Ograniczenia:
- Wysokie wymagania technologiczne – Wymaga inwestycji w zaawansowaną infrastrukturę IT, nowoczesne oprogramowanie oraz szybkie łącza sieciowe.
- Ryzyko błędów systemowych i awarii – Usterki w algorytmach lub systemach technicznych mogą prowadzić do poważnych strat finansowych lub destabilizacji rynków.
- Potencjał do zwiększania niestabilności rynków – Zwiększona automatyzacja może prowadzić do gwałtownych wahań cen i wzrostu zmienności, szczególnie w okresach dużej niepewności rynkowej.
Najważniejsze regulacje dotyczące handlu algorytmicznego
Handel algorytmiczny podlega nadzorowi ze strony instytucji regulujących rynki finansowe, takich jak Komisja Nadzoru Finansowego w Polsce, Europejski Urząd Nadzoru Giełd i Papierów Wartościowych (ESMA) czy amerykańska Komisja Papierów Wartościowych i Giełd (SEC). Przepisy obejmują wymogi dotyczące testowania, monitorowania i dokumentowania algorytmów oraz zarządzania ryzykiem operacyjnym i systemowym.
Regulacje mają na celu zapewnienie stabilności rynków, przeciwdziałanie manipulacjom oraz ochronę interesów inwestorów, a także szybkie identyfikowanie i ograniczanie potencjalnych negatywnych skutków awarii technologicznych lub nadużyć.
Inne pojęcia ze Słownika inwestora: